Output 85457d332716e3df442a1d3197fdd4cf6e66b28f405afb4dee7d5a9292b19220:0

value
13365993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ba3de04f8ad882362e53d8dc598a09948ca76e6 OP_EQUAL
address
3LFmQBXpUdxW8GaQ6CfnLNPRF6y5hwxSpd
transaction
85457d332716e3df442a1d3197fdd4cf6e66b28f405afb4dee7d5a9292b19220
spent
true